Hello, I am in a quite big of a trouble here trying to get Wiimmfi work for Mario Kart on Dolphin. I did everything correctly, used the unbanner but I get a error code called "23918". I searched it up and I was redirected to a guide on Dolphin's website. I installed the NAND files to my SD from my Wii and followed the tutorial exactly. I pasted the files from the "nand" folder to Documents/Dolphin Emulator/Wii. I launched up the game and I still get the same error.

Is there anything else I could do? What am I doing wrong? How do I fix it?

Wiimmfi has a 7 day activation period. After the seven days are up you should be able to start playing. (This is what the error code is about don't worry it's completely normal).

I looked it up and it said

"Error

23918
Wiimmfi: Wiimmfi access denied (maybe standard NAND of Dolphin).
Note
23918
Too many users share the same Dolphin configuration. So consoles are not unique.
Solution
23918
For Dolphin users: Use a copy of your Wii NAND."
